Summary |
The aim of this study was to examine changes in the mRNA transcriptional profile of spermatozoa in Holstein-Friesian bulls. Spermatozoa from bulls divergent for feritlity status were used for this study with 10 High fertility bulls and 10 Low fertility bulls. RNA was extracted and subsequently subjected to miRNAseq analysis. 6 miRNA were identified as differentially expressed in the spermatozoa between bulls of high and low feritlity status.

Overall design |
In total 20 spermatozoa RNA samples were analysed. 10 samples were derived from bulls which ranked for high fertility status (High, n=10) and 10 samples were derived from low fertility status bulls (Low, n=10). Total RNA was extracted from a pool of frozen-thawed semen from three different ejaculates per bull.
